- Best time: October to March for comfortable weather and festivals.
- Summer (April to June) for beach destinations and warm weather.
- Monsoon season (July to September) for lush landscapes and fewer tourists.
_Where to Go_
- _North India_:
- Delhi: Iconic landmarks, vibrant markets, and rich history.
- Agra: Taj Mahal, Red Fort, and Mughal heritage.
- Rajasthan: Jaipur, Udaipur, and Jodhpur for palaces, forts, and desert landscapes.
- _South India_:
- Kerala: Backwaters, beaches, and Ayurvedic retreats.
- Tamil Nadu: Chennai, Madurai, and Tanjore for temples, culture, and cuisine.
- Karnataka: Bengaluru, Mysuru, and Hampi for palaces, ruins, and natural beauty.
- _East India_:
- West Bengal: Kolkata, Darjeeling, and Sundarbans for culture, tea plantations, and wildlife.
- Odisha: Bhubaneswar, Puri, and Konark for temples, beaches, and tribal culture.
- _West India_:
- Maharashtra: Mumbai, Pune, and Goa for beaches, nightlife, and Bollywood.
- Gujarat: Ahmedabad, Gandhinagar, and Rann of Kutch for culture, history, and natural beauty.

_Practical Tips_
- Visa requirements: Check if you need a visa to enter India.
- Vaccinations: Consult your doctor about recommended vaccinations.
- Safety: Take necessary precautions, especially in crowded areas.
- Transportation: Book flights, trains, and buses in advance.
- Respect local customs, dress modestly, and learn basic phrases.
